Index de l'article
Oracle Database 10g
Architecture Oracle
Serveur Oracle
Mémoire PGA
Instance Oracle
La SGA (System Global Area)
Zone de mémoire partagée

Architecture Oracle 10g

En tant que DBA Oracle (administrateur de bases de données), vous aurez pour mission les tâches suivantes:

  1. Choix de la configuration matérielle du serveur qui va héberger le logiciel Oracle
  2. installation et configuration du logiciel Oracle 1Og sur votre machine serveur
  3. Création de la base de données proprement dite
  4. Gérer l'instance Oracle associée.
  5. Créer et gérer les tables et autres objets utilisés par les applications
  6. Créer et gérer les utilisateurs de la base de données
  7. Maintenir une stratégie de sauvegarde et de récupération fiable pour votre base de données
  8. Surveillance et réglage des performances de la base.

Pour couvrir tous ces aspects d'administration et d'optimisation de votre base de données oracle, la liste des tutoriels publiés sera extensible et enrichie incéssamment. Pour bien démarrer votre mission en tant que DBA, vous devez comprendre parfaitement l'architecture oracle et ses mécanismes sous-jacents.

Comprendre le fonctionnement du système de gestion de bases de données Oracle, la relation entre les structures mémoire, les processus d'arrière-plan , et les activités d’E/S est, en effet, essentielle avant d'apprendre à gérer tous ces composants.

Serveur de base de données

Pour intéragir avec la base de données, les utilisateurs ont besoin de comptes utilisateur et d’une connexion réseau pour y accéder. Ils doivent également disposer d'une capacité de stockage suffisante pour l’insertion de données.

client-serveur.gif

C’est le schéma courant de connexion à une base de données Oracle en mode client/serveur. Pour une connexion en mode 3-tiers, voici le schéma de connexion :

n-tiers.gif

Composants du serveur Oracle

Le schéma suivant présente les principaux composants d’un serveur Oracle :

architecture-oracle.gif

Ce schéma peut paraître, à première vue, complexe. Toutefois, il n'est pas du tout compliqué. Pour une parfaite compréhension, on va faire un zoom progressif dans les sections qui suivent pour décrire plus en détail chacun de ses composants.

Chaque nouveau terme introduit prématurément dans une section du fait de la forte corrélation des composants, sera traité plus en détail dans les sections qui suivent.



 

Copyright © 2009-2012 tuto-dba-oracle.com - Tous Droits Réservés -